ホームページ > データベース > Oracle > Oracleデータベースからディレクトリを削除する方法

Oracleデータベースからディレクトリを削除する方法

PHPz
リリース: 2023-04-04 10:06:55
オリジナル
737 人が閲覧しました

Oracle データベースでは、ディレクトリの削除はそれほど複雑な操作ではありませんが、習得するにはある程度の練習が必要な場合があります。この記事では、プロセスを完全に理解するために、Oracle データベースからディレクトリを削除する方法について詳しく説明します。

始める前に、データベース操作に関連するいくつかの用語と基本知識を習得していることを確認する必要があります。さらにヘルプが必要な場合は、Oracle の公式ドキュメントおよびその他の関連リソースを参照することをお勧めします。

最初のステップはディレクトリの名前を見つけることです

ディレクトリを削除する前に、削除するディレクトリの名前を知っておく必要があります。これは通常、Oracle のデータ ディクショナリ ビューをクエリすることによって実現されます。次のクエリを使用して、すべてのディレクトリを一覧表示できます。

1

SELECT * FROM USER_DIRECTORIES;

ログイン後にコピー
ログイン後にコピー

これにより、現在のユーザーが所有するすべてのディレクトリに関する情報 (ディレクトリの名前、パス、説明など) が一覧表示されます。削除するディレクトリの名前を決定したら、次のステップに進むことができます。

2 番目のステップ、ディレクトリを削除します。

ディレクトリ名がわかったら、ディレクトリを削除するのは非常に簡単です。次のコマンドを使用するだけです:

1

DROP DIRECTORY <directory_name>;

ログイン後にコピー

ここで、 は削除するディレクトリの名前です。このコマンドを実行すると、Oracle は指定された名前のディレクトリとそこに保存されているファイルを削除します。

ディレクトリの削除には十分な権限が必要であり、ディレクトリとその中のファイルを削除すると復元できないことに注意してください。したがって、削除コマンドを実行する前に、貴重なファイルをすべてバックアップしていることと、ディレクトリを削除するリスクを十分に理解していることを確認してください。

3 番目のステップは、ディレクトリが削除されたかどうかを確認することです。

ディレクトリが Oracle データベースから削除されたことを確認するには、次のコマンドを使用して、ディレクトリのすべてのディレクトリをクエリします。現在のユーザー:

1

SELECT * FROM USER_DIRECTORIES;

ログイン後にコピー
ログイン後にコピー

If 指定された名前のディレクトリは正常に削除されたため、その名前はこのリストに表示されなくなります。

結論

Oracle データベース内のディレクトリの削除は複雑な操作ではありませんが、削除する前に十分な権限を確保し、明確に理解する必要があります。この記事では、データ ディクショナリ ビューを使用してディレクトリ名を検索し、DROP DIRECTORY コマンドを使用してディレクトリを削除する方法について説明します。さらに、ディレクトリが正常に削除されたことを確認する方法についても説明します。これらの手順を実際にマスターすると、より有能で自信を持った Oracle データベース管理者になれます。

以上がOracleデータベースからディレクトリを削除する方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

ソース:php.cn
この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ート